“The New Geek”

A new breed of IT professional is emerging, one with a technical background
who can channel his skills into multiple disciplines: These so-called “New
Geeks” are expected to help usher in what IBM’s Irving Wladawsky-Berger
calls the “post-technology” era, in which technology tools are applied to …
